What's The Definition Of Oscitancy?
[n] an involuntary intake of breath through a wide open mouth; usually triggered by fatigue or boredom; "he could not suppress a yawn"; "the yawning in the audience told him it was time to stop"; "he apologized for his ostinancy"
[n] drowsiness and dullness manifested by yawning Synonyms | Synonyms for Oscitancy: oscitance | oscitance | yawn | yawning Related Terms | Find terms related to Oscitancy: See Also | drowsiness | dullness | dulness | inborn reflex | innate reflex | instinctive reflex | obtuseness | pandiculation | physiological reaction | reflex | sleepiness | somnolence | unconditioned reflex Oscitancy In Webster's Dictionary \Os"ci*tan*cy\, n. [See {Oscitant}.]
1. The act of gaping or yawning.
2. Drowsiness; dullness; sluggishness. --Hallam.
It might proceed from the oscitancy of transcribers.
--Addison.
